About The Position

This role is responsible for determining food items and preparing them for service. The cook will prepare appetizing and appealing food from scratch, execute culinary knife skills, and follow standardized recipes. They will cook and prepare food in quantities according to the menu, par level, and number of persons to be served, and observe and test foods to determine if they have been cooked sufficiently. The cook will also be responsible for dishes, ordering supplies, maintaining proper food temperature log sheets, and maintaining proper cooking/quick chill log sheets. They will portion and dish food according to diet tickets, weigh items when necessary, and perform dishwashing as needed. The position requires knowledge of various cooking procedures and methods (grilling, baking, boiling, etc.) and maintaining a clean and sanitized work area, tables, counters, cabinets, ovens, and other kitchen equipment utilizing proper sanitation techniques. Adherence to department safety and sanitation regulations, and the use of protective barriers (gloves, apron, proper hair covering) are essential. Excellent customer service skills and the ability to work well on a team and independently are also required.
